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9-inch springform pan. Prepare the brownie mix according to package instructions, usually combining it with eggs and oil. Pour the mixture into the prepared pan and bake for 25–30 minutes until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
- In a m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th and creamy. Gradually add the sugar and vanilla extract, mixing until fully combined. Add the room temperature eggs one at a time, beating until just blended.
- Once the brownie base is done baking and cooled slightly, pour the cheesecake mixture over the brownie base, then drizzle caramel sauce and gently swirl it for a marble effect.
- Bake the cheesecake in the preheated oven for approximately 45–50 minutes until the edges are set and the center has a slight wobble. Avoid opening the oven door during baking to prevent cracks.
- After baking, turn off the oven and leave the cheesecake inside with the door slightly ajar for about 1 hour. Once cooled to room temperature, refrigerate for at least 4 hours before serving.

Notes
For best results, use room temperature ingredients and chill the cheesecake for at least 4 hours before serving to allow flavors to meld beautifully.
